qt在没有环境下如何运行exe 打包流程-亲测简介可用

文章介绍了使用Qt创建的release版本exe进行打包的步骤,包括复制exe,创建自定义文件夹,通过windeployqt命令添加必要依赖,使得打包后的文件夹即使在无Qt环境的电脑上也能运行。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

配图 

文字流程叙述:

0-最好使用release 生成的exe 进行打包,不然最后的文件会特别大几个G (用relese生成的exe打包几十MB)
1-用release生成的exe单独复制一份,放入一个自定义的文件夹
2-打开qt编译器命令框(注意用对应的版本去打包) 输入: windeployqt  自定义文件夹的路径                  敲一下回车即可

 图1 将生成的release版本下的exe 复制一下

  图2 将生成的release版本下的exe 复制一下,然后复制到一个你自定义的文件夹中

   图3  打开qt命令框编译器 输入windeployqt  后面跟上你自定义文件夹的路径 敲一下回车即可

 图4  在自定义的文件夹中生成这些dll和一些新的文件夹 即可正常使用

 结尾:到这里只需要把自定义文件夹发给别人,即使别人没有qt环境也可以运行。

如果 图3 不知道从哪里打开的可以参考如下:

 

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值